Job Description
This job opening is for a Receptionist position located in St. George, Utah. The role is a full-time opportunity with a temporary duration expected to last around 12 weeks. However, the length of this assignment may be shorter or longer depending on business needs. There is also a possibility for the position to become permanent based on factors such as individual performance, organizational requirements, and mutual fit between the employee and employer.

Job Duties
- Adheres to and conveys a philosophy that supports the dignity, privacy, independence, choice, and individuality of residents
- answers telephones and directs the caller to the appropriate associate, transferring callers to an associate's voice mailbox when the associate is unavailable
- greets visitors in a friendly, interested, and helpful manner
- assists in ordering, receiving, stocking and distribution of office supplies
- act as main point of contact for residents, family members, and guests
- helps with related clerical duties such as photocopying, faxing, filing, collating, and any other tasks as requested by the supervisor
- performs other duties as assigned
